Adhyāya 42 (Śānti Parva): Śrāddha, Aurdhvadaihika Rites, and Royal Welfare Measures

सुहृदां कारयामास सर्वेषामौर्ध्वदेहिकम्‌ । साथ ही उनके निमित्त पाण्डुपुत्र युधिष्ठिरने धर्मशालाएँ, प्याऊ-चर और पोखरे बनवाये। इस प्रकार उन्होंने सभी सुहृदोंके श्राद्ध-कर्म सम्पन्न कराये

suhṛdāṃ kārayāmāsa sarveṣām aurdhvadehikam |

ବୈଶମ୍ପାୟନ କହିଲେ—ପାଣ୍ଡୁପୁତ୍ର ଯୁଧିଷ୍ଠିର ନିଜ ସମସ୍ତ ସୁହୃଦଙ୍କ ପାଇଁ ଔର୍ଧ୍ୱଦେହିକ (ଶ୍ରାଦ୍ଧ) କର୍ମ ସମ୍ପାଦନ କରାଇଲେ। ତଦୁପରି ସେମାନଙ୍କ ନିମିତ୍ତେ ଧର୍ମଶାଳା, ପାନୀୟ-ଛତ୍ର (ପ୍ୟାଉ) ଓ ପୋଖରୀ ନିର୍ମାଣ କରାଇଲେ। ଏହିପରି ସେ ସମସ୍ତ ସୁହୃଦଙ୍କ ଶ୍ରାଦ୍ଧକର୍ମ ସମାପ୍ତ କଲେ।

Dharma after loss is expressed through gratitude and responsible action: honoring the departed with proper rites and transforming grief into compassionate public welfare (charity that benefits many).

After the war, Yudhiṣṭhira arranges the aurdhvadehika/śrāddha rites for all his well-wishers and supports their memory by commissioning charitable works such as rest-houses, water-stations, and ponds.
